Title: Satoshi Shimokawabe: Innovator in Electric Power Steering Technology

Introduction

Satoshi Shimokawabe is a notable inventor based in Maebashi,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of electric power steering systems, holding a total of 4 patents. His innovative designs have enhanced the functionality and efficiency of steering mechanisms in vehicles.

Latest Patents

Shimokawabe's latest patents include advanced electric power steering apparatuses. One of his inventions focuses on a system that drives a motor based on a current command value, assisting in the control of the steering system. This apparatus features a handle-returning control section that calculates the target steering angle velocity based on various parameters, including steering torque and vehicle speed. Another patent describes a similar electric power steering apparatus that compensates for steering angular velocity, ensuring a smoother driving experience.
